Hello fellow consumers, here's my review:
Pros: *Perfect size for my small kitchen--spacious enough to handle large foodstuffs
*grip handles functional with oven mits/towels and have not slipped
*thick glass-doesn't feel cheap or flimsy
*attractive
*Cooks food evenly
Cons: *NOT easy to clean once burnt and stuck-on grease is present--solution to better facilitate this issue: use foil paper coated with butter/oil of any kind
Conclusion: it's a pyrex, so you're def getting good quality product. Just read the brief instructions before use and you're good to go. Hope you enjoy it like i have.

The item description is somewhat misleading. The length is measured from outside handle to outside handle. I purchased the item thinking it was the inside dimensions. I should have purchased the larger baking dish. It works fine but a little small.

I have a lot of pans in my kitchen, and only 5 I think I'd rather give up all my wooden spoons than do without. This is one of them. I've used it up to 425 degrees F without any issues and I use for almost everything. Roasting, lasagna, meatloaf. It's my main dish pan.
Because it's glass, it's very easy to clean. You can use a metal scrubbie on it and it won't damage the glass.
